simply go to the tpl and remove the block that all..
include/templates folder edit the tpl ..
I think that sums up religion quite nicely.
you mean "you think that this sums up religion quite nicely?"
Do explain your reason or thoughts on your remark?
I have not seen a great debate on punbb in a while..
God's Busy
A United States Marine was attending some college courses between assignments. He had completed missions in Iraq and Afghanistan. One of the courses had a professor who was an avowed atheist and a member of the ACLU. One day the professor shocked the class when he came in. He looked to the ceiling and flatly stated, "God, if you are real, then I want you to knock me off this platform. I'll give you exactly 15 minutes."
The lecture room fell silent. You could hear a pin drop. Ten minutes went by and the professor proclaimed, "Here I am God. I'm still waiting."
It got down to the last couple of minutes when the Marine got out of his chair, went up to the professor, and cold-cocked him; knocking him off the platform. The professor was out cold. The Marine went back to his seat and sat there, silently. The other students were shocked and stunned and sat there looking on in silence.
The professor eventually came to, noticeably shaken, looked at the Marine and asked, "What the heck is the matter with you? Why did you do that?"
The Marine calmly replied, "God was too busy today protecting America's soldiers who are protecting your right to say stupid stuff and act like an idiot. So, He sent me."
If you don't know GOD, don't make stupid remarks!!!!!!!
lmao>>> I had to share this with you!
some one say paid style? humm.....
more info please?
i would like to see sometype of admin control for the mod.
for creating channels( a channel called shoutbox) and such.
and how to integrate this in to punbb more?
not talking about iframes.
creating a punbb page and droppin the code to pull the chat.
so sometype of example on how to create styles for it so that it like the main site with links and such.
GOOGLE >>> what is my ip? from work!!
they have a vpn setup from one building to another.
easiest thing would be setup localhost and have everyone inside hit the portal.
for remote functions i would look at the router to forward the port to that machine
a link off the main site. maybe mask the ip so that it would look like etc.
do they host there own website? then it would be a simple task..
post ur code if you dont mind... maybe someone else could use it?
or maybe we could make it better..haha
any one got picture of the eating of the hat?
the site looks kewl...
Q id for punbb and punres user to talk about anything they want!
anything goes! just respect other users if you are going to talk bad about them.
read rules!!!!
image verification with captcha! with spamhaus *thanks to Matt"
my portal mod!
ajax live chat mod!
my index mod "thanks to the guys who help design it with me"
why not do a whole style that way instead of the front page only?
ummm sorta ugly....
here a question for ur admin_options..
how many times will it take you to get it right the first time?
(hint 100000000000000000000000000000000000000000000)
kewl marky-poo!!
hummm that looks like wordpress(lmao>>>)
would be nice to see punbb blog system in there..
matt, humm.... hahaha. that kewl. but i have notice a bug in ie7 sometimes the txt and img are super big with that mod. but once i refresh it fine..
dr J fixed that now..
matt, im looking in to that..
seem sometimes IE7 does load the right images and txt right the first load. can u try to refresh it and see it goes a way?
that a site bug not a style issue.
post the code fool...
so other can have it as well
can u screen print it?
because in ff ie7 and safari it look fine...
i stopped doing anything for ie6 version..haha..
p.s. first complaint.. lmao>>>
I have created another style for
here is the style for download!
if ur going to complain about my style please keep it down to a few...LMAO>>
can someone take this a bit farther and create a admin panel where the admin creates the Question and answer?
ok create a whole new group and give them certain rights to each thread.
simple way of doing it Pog.
Q and edit all the topics
admin -> forum -> change the permission on members to read only promote all the user that can write to Moderators
ok i understand now. thanks for everyones input on this topic...
im looking at your code and i dont see the part with the icon_type in there. I even upload the script to my site and it is not there.
this is my index.php u will find the references to the $icon_type for the db query and the rest of the code.
i hope this will help you !
define('PUN_PORTAL', 1);
define('PUN_ROOT', './');
define('PUN_QUIET_VISIT', 1);
require PUN_ROOT.'include/common.php';
$page_title = pun_htmlspecialchars($pun_config['o_board_title']);
define('PUN_ALLOW_INDEX', 1);
require PUN_ROOT.'header.php';
require PUN_ROOT.'include/parser.php';
function pun_news($fid='', $show=15, $truncate=1)
global $lang_common, $db, $pun_config, $db_prefix;
$max_subject_length = 30;
$show_max_topics = 50;
$fid = intval($fid);
$order_by = 't.posted';
$forum_sql = '';
// Was a forum ID supplied?
if ( $fid ) $forum_sql = ''.$fid.' AND ';
$show = intval($show);
if ($show < 1 || $show > $show_max_topics)
$show = 15;
// Fetch $show topics
$result = $db->query('SELECT, t.poster, t.subject, t.posted, t.last_post, AS fid, f.forum_name FROM '.$db_prefix.'topics AS t INNER JOIN '.$db_prefix.'forums AS f ON WHERE'.$fid.' AND t.moved_to IS NULL ORDER BY '.$order_by.' DESC') or error('Unable to fetch topic list', __FILE__, __LINE__, $db->error());
$show_count = 0;
if ( !$db->num_rows($result) ) return $output;
while ( ($show_count < $show) && ($cur_topic = $db->fetch_assoc($result)) ) {
$temp = '';
if ($pun_config['o_censoring'] == '1')
$cur_topic['subject'] = censor_words($cur_topic['subject']);
if (pun_strlen($cur_topic['subject']) > $max_subject_length)
$subject_truncated = trim(substr($cur_topic['subject'], 0, ($max_subject_length-5))).' ...';
$subject_truncated = $cur_topic['subject'];
$newsheading = '<a href="'.$pun_config['o_base_url'].'/viewtopic.php?id='.$cur_topic['id'].'&action=new" title="'.pun_htmlspecialchars($cur_topic['subject']).'">'.pun_htmlspecialchars($subject_truncated).'</a> - <em>Posted by '.$cur_topic['poster'].' at '.date('h:i A', $cur_topic['posted']).'</em><br />';
// Group posts by date
$thisdate = date('l, d F Y', $cur_topic['posted']);
if ($thisdate != $saveddate)
if ($saveddate)
$temp .= "</div></div>";
$temp .= '<div class="block"><h2><span>'.$thisdate.'</span></h2><div class="box"><div class="inbox"><p>';
$saveddate = $thisdate;
else {
$temp .= '<div class="inbox"><p>';
$temp .= $newsheading.'</p>';
$id = $cur_topic['id'];
$msg = $db->query('SELECT id, poster, poster_id, poster_ip, poster_email, message, posted, edited, edited_by FROM '.$db_prefix.'posts WHERE topic_id='.$id.' LIMIT 1') or error('Unable to fetch post info', __FILE__, __LINE__, $db->error());
if ( !$db->num_rows($msg) ) continue;
$cur_post = $db->fetch_assoc($msg);
// Display first paragraph only (comment out next four lines to turn off)
if ($truncate == 1)
$paragraph = preg_split("/s*n+/", $cur_post['message']);
if (isset($paragraph[1])) {
$cur_post['message'] = $paragraph[0] . "...";
$cur_post['message'] = parse_message($cur_post['message'], 0);
$temp .= $cur_post['message'];
$temp .= "</div>";
if (isset($output)) {
$output .= $temp;
else {
$output = $temp;
} // end of while
$output .= "</div></div>";
return $output;
PunBB Active Topics
Copyright 2004-2005 Alex King,
This is a mod for PunBB,
PunBB is Copyright (C) 2002, 2003, 2004 Rickard Andersson (
This file is based on the viewtopic.php file in PunBB.
You can see this in action at the Use Tasks forums:
To install, include this file below the forums list in your index.php file:
$ak_limit = 10; // change this to the number of active topics you want to display.
$result = $db->query('
FROM '.$db->prefix.'topics AS t
INNER JOIN '.$db->prefix.'forums AS f
LEFT JOIN '.$db->prefix.'forum_perms AS fp
ON (
AND fp.group_id='.$pun_user['g_id'].'
fp.read_forum IS NULL
OR fp.read_forum=1
ORDER BY t.last_post DESC
LIMIT '.$ak_limit
) or error('Unable to fetch topic list', __FILE__, __LINE__, $db->error());
require PUN_ROOT.'lang/'.$pun_user['language'].'/forum.php';
<div id="vf" class="blocktable">
<h2><span>Recent Posts</span></h2>
<div class="box">
<div class="inbox">
<table cellspacing="0">
<th class="tcl" scope="col"><?php echo $lang_common['Topic'] ?></th>
<th class="tc2" scope="col"><?php echo $lang_common['Replies'] ?></th>
<th class="tc3" scope="col"><?php echo $lang_forum['Views'] ?></th>
<th class="tcr" scope="col"><?php echo $lang_common['Last post'] ?></th>
// If there are topics in this forum.
if ($db->num_rows($result))
while ($cur_topic = $db->fetch_assoc($result))
$icon_text = $lang_common['Normal icon'];
$item_status = '';
$icon_type = 'icon';
if ($cur_topic['moved_to'] == null)
$last_post = '<a href="viewtopic.php?pid='.$cur_topic['last_post_id'].'#p'.$cur_topic['last_post_id'].'">'.format_time($cur_topic['last_post']).'</a> <span class="byuser">'.$lang_common['by'].' '.pun_htmlspecialchars($cur_topic['last_poster']).'</span>';
$last_post = ' ';
if ($pun_config['o_censoring'] == '1')
$cur_topic['subject'] = censor_words($cur_topic['subject']);
if ($cur_topic['moved_to'] != 0)
$subject = $lang_forum['Moved'].': <a href="viewtopic.php?id='.$cur_topic['moved_to'].'">'.pun_htmlspecialchars($cur_topic['subject']).'</a> <span class="byuser">'.$lang_common['by'].' '.pun_htmlspecialchars($cur_topic['poster']).'</span>';
else if ($cur_topic['closed'] == '0')
$subject = '<a href="viewtopic.php?id='.$cur_topic['id'].'">'.pun_htmlspecialchars($cur_topic['subject']).'</a> <span class="byuser">'.$lang_common['by'].' '.pun_htmlspecialchars($cur_topic['poster']).'</span>';
$subject = '<a href="viewtopic.php?id='.$cur_topic['id'].'">'.pun_htmlspecialchars($cur_topic['subject']).'</a> <span class="byuser">'.$lang_common['by'].' '.pun_htmlspecialchars($cur_topic['poster']).'</span>';
$icon_text = $lang_common['Closed icon'];
$item_status = 'iclosed';
if (!$pun_user['is_guest'] && $cur_topic['last_post'] > $pun_user['last_visit'] && $cur_topic['moved_to'] == null)
$icon_text .= ' '.$lang_common['New icon'];
$item_status .= ' inew';
$icon_type = 'icon inew';
$subject = '<strong>'.$subject.'</strong>';
$subject_new_posts = '<span class="newtext">[ <a href="viewtopic.php?id='.$cur_topic['id'].'&action=new" title="'.$lang_common['New posts info'].'">'.$lang_common['New posts'].'</a> ]</span>';
$subject_new_posts = null;
// Should we display the dot or not? :)
if (1 == 0 && !$pun_user['is_guest'] && $pun_config['o_show_dot'] == '1')
if ($cur_topic['has_posted'] == $pun_user['id'])
$subject = '<strong>·</strong> '.$subject;
$subject = ' '.$subject;
if ($cur_topic['sticky'] == '1')
$subject = '<span class="stickytext">'.$lang_forum['Sticky'].': </span>'.$subject;
$item_status .= ' isticky';
$icon_text .= ' '.$lang_forum['Sticky'];
$num_pages_topic = ceil(($cur_topic['num_replies'] + 1) / $pun_user['disp_posts']);
if ($num_pages_topic > 1)
$subject_multipage = '[ '.paginate($num_pages_topic, -1, 'viewtopic.php?id='.$cur_topic['id']).' ]';
$subject_multipage = null;
// Should we show the "New posts" and/or the multipage links?
if (!empty($subject_new_posts) || !empty($subject_multipage))
$subject .= ' '.(!empty($subject_new_posts) ? $subject_new_posts : '');
$subject .= !empty($subject_multipage) ? ' '.$subject_multipage : '';
<tr<?php if ($item_status != '') echo ' class="'.trim($item_status).'"'; ?>>
<td class="tcl">
<div class="intd">
<div class="<?php echo $icon_type ?>"><div class="nosize"><?php echo trim($icon_text) ?></div></div>
<div class="tclcon">
<?php echo $subject."\n" ?>
<td class="tc2"><?php echo ($cur_topic['moved_to'] == null) ? $cur_topic['num_replies'] : ' ' ?></td>
<td class="tc3"><?php echo ($cur_topic['moved_to'] == null) ? $cur_topic['num_views'] : ' ' ?></td>
<td class="tcr"><?php echo $last_post ?></td>
<td class="tcl" colspan="4"><?php echo $lang_forum['Empty forum'] ?></td>
echo pun_news(1, 5, 0);
require PUN_ROOT.'footer.php';
